Are you searching for top-tier replacement windows in Stratford, CT? Your home's value and energy performance can be dramatically improved with the right windows. The town of Stratford boasts a diverse selection of https://kallumygvr601758.blog-mall.com/36441853/top-replacement-windows-in-stratford-ct